**Ticket PARITY-412: Kestrel SDK catch-up**

Quick one for the weekly sync: the Kestrel-Go SDK is still missing batched uploads and retry hints that Kestrel-JS shipped two releases ago. Partner teams keep asking. Plan is to land both behind a flag this sprint and cut a minor release. Needs a sign-off from the owner named below.

account owner for bajef-badup: Drueth Kelath Pelael Holwyn

Management Meeting Minutes — Inventory Write-Down

Attendees: operations, finance, warehousing. Prepared for the incoming director.

Agreed: write down the Fenridge spare-parts stock held at the Dunharrow depot. Cause: discontinued Orlix line, no resale channel. Finance to book the charge this period. Warehousing to scrap or donate per policy. No customer impact expected. Action owners confirmed; review in four weeks. Incoming director to ratify disposal terms on arrival. Strategic background is recorded in the note below.

confidential, yagag-tagep: Project Quenox slips by a full year because of the staffing delay.

### Step 4: Migrate per-tenant rate quotas

Quick one for the release cut: quotas move from the old flat-file config into the Quotarium tenants table. Run `quotarium migrate --tenants all` once, then spot-check a couple of heavy tenants. The migrator needs direct database access, so export the connection string shown below before running it.

replica DSN, kajep-yahag: mssql://praok_svc:iF@db-8d68.plorvaio.local:5432/eliion

TURN-208: Gatevale turnstile counters at the Merrow Field pilot double-count when a rotation reverses mid-cycle. Attendance totals drift roughly 2% high per event. The debounce window fix is implemented, reviewed by Ilsa, and soak-tested across two simulated match days without drift. Ready for your cut; the candidate build is identified below.

trace token, tagag-tafog: htk6_5ed18c